Grégoire, Jean-Pierre

About Me


Dr Jean-Pierre Grégoire’s work has changed competencies and roles of pharmacists as health professionals. He pioneered the teaching of pharmacoepidemiology in a faculty of pharmacy. As Dean of Pharmacy at Laval University, he led the creation of a competency-based entry-level PharmD program innovative in both design and instructional methods. As a researcher, he contributed to better characterize adherence to drug treatments. As president of the Quebec Order of Pharmacists, he led a change in pharmacy legislation that requires Quebec pharmacies to have a private section for counselling, and reinforced the deontology code that led pharmacists to stop selling tobacco products.
